China will continue to build strategic cooperation with Russia “back to back”, promoting together with it the principles of a multipolar world. This was stated on Friday, March 17, by Chinese Ambassador to the Russian Federation Zhang Hanhui in an interview. RIA News.
According to the diplomat, Beijing and Moscow will continue to provide reliable guarantees for global stability and strategic balance.
“Today the world is restless. However, the more instability there is in the world, the more confidently Chinese-Russian relations go forward,” he said.
Zhang Hanhui also stressed that the Russian Federation and China have embarked on the path of friendly coexistence of major powers and created an example of a new type of international relations. The ambassador added that the interaction between Beijing and Moscow is based on the principles of non-alignment with blocs and is not directed against third parties, therefore it does not allow interference and provocations from other states.
Earlier, the Russian Foreign Ministry said that Russian-Chinese relations are are above the military alliance, they have no restrictions and limits. According to the head of the ministry, Russia’s rapprochement with Eastern countries is inevitable.
